Study on Purification and Chemical Compositions of Tea Polysaccharide (TPS-Ⅱ)with Antioxidant Activity
PAN Jian1,CHEN Yan1,2,*,FANG Wei2,SUN Yu-jun3
2009, 30(3):  25-28.  doi:10.7506/spkx1002-6630-200903003
Asbtract ( 1329 )   HTML ( 0)   PDF (375KB) ( 578 )  
Related Articles | Metrics

The tea polysaccharids (TPS)-Ⅱ with antioxidant activity was isolated from the water extract of Liu'an roasted green tea by chromatography. The compositions of TPS-II were identified by electrophoresis and FPLC (fast protein liquid chromatography). The molecular weight of TPS-Ⅱ is 1.01×105 D, and its contents of total saccharide, uronic acid and protein are 85.3%, 28.0% and 2.8% respectively. GC analysis showed that TPS- Ⅱ is composed of L-Rha, L-Fuc, L-Ara, D-Xyl, DMan, D-Glc and D-Gal in molar ratio of 2.98:1.58:4.27:1.00:1.82:2.25:6.98. The IR spectrum of TPS-Ⅱ also presents the peak of polysaccharide absorption characteristics. Furthermore, β-elimination reaction demonstrated that the polysaccharide in TPS- Ⅱ is linked to peptide chains via non-O-glycosidic linkage.

Study on Extraction Technology, Structure and Free Radical Scavenging Activity of Polysaccharides from Gastrodia elata B1
LIU Ming-xue,LI Qiong-fang,LIU Qiang,HUANG Zhi-qiang,QIU Fan
2009, 30(3):  29-32.  doi:10.7506/spkx1002-6630-200903004
Asbtract ( 1527 )   HTML ( 1)   PDF (380KB) ( 653 )  
Related Articles | Metrics

Polysaccharides were extracted from Gastrodia elata B1 with water and precipitated by ethanol, purified through cetyltrimethylammonium bromide (CTAB) complex method and Sepharose 6-fast flow chromatography. The structural characterization of Gastrodia elata B1 polysaccharides (GPS) was conducted by means of IR and NMR techniques. In simulated chemical reaction system, the scavenging effects of GPS on ·OH and O2· were investigated via Fenton reaction and pyrogallol autoxidation method repectively. Results showed that the optimal extraction technology conditions are as follows: extraction temperature 80 ℃, extraction times 2, solid-liquid ratio 1:40 and using 75% ethanol as precipitant. IR and 1H-NMR analysis indicated that GPS are composed of D-glucopyranose. The 13C-NMR results revealed that GPS are a (1→4) linked α-D-glucan, which is attached by glucosyl side chains at O-6 of the glucosyl residues of main chain. The IC50 of crude GPS and purified GPS to ·OH are 1.18 mg/ml and 1.62 mg/ml respectively, and those O2· are 0.81 mg/ml and 1.03 mg/ml respectively. In conclusion, GPS have a structure of (1→4) linked α-D-glucan with branching residues and certain capacity of scavenging free radicals.

Study on Stability of Carotenoids from Photosynthetic Bacteria
HAN Yong-bin,LIU Gui-ling,CHEN De-ming,LU Ying-shuang,GU Zhen-xin*
2009, 30(3):  43-46.  doi:10.7506/spkx1002-6630-200903008
Asbtract ( 1477 )   HTML ( 0)   PDF (174KB) ( 507 )  
Related Articles | Metrics

In this study, effects of metal ion, NaOH, light and H2O2 on stability of carotenoids from photosynthetic bacteria were investigated. It was found that K+, Na+, Mg2+, Al3+, Ca2+ and NaOH with low concentration (less than 0.01 mol/L) have little effects on the stability of carotenoids, while Fe3+ , Cu2+ and NaOH with high concentration(more than 0.5 mol/L)may lead to great loss of carotenoids. The carotenoids are sensitive to light and the damage effects of lights from different sources on stability of carotenoids decrease as following: natural light > bulb light > fluorescent light > ultraviolet light. But the carotenoids are stable to H2O2, only a little carotenoids are decomposed when H2O2 exists.

Changes in Microbe Quantity and Physico-chemical Properties during Processing of Cured Silver Carp
ZENG Ling-bin1,XIONG Shan-bai1,2,*,WANG Li1
2009, 30(3):  54-57.  doi:10.7506/spkx1002-6630-200903011
Asbtract ( 1525 )   HTML ( 1)   PDF (210KB) ( 434 )  
Related Articles | Metrics

The changes in microbe quantity and physico-chemical properties were studied during processing of cured silver carp through traditional method. Over the whole processing, moisture declines but NaCl content increases significantly. The growth of various microorganisms slows down, and the contents of non-protein nitrogen and free amino acids decrease during the curing. However, the microbe amount significantly increases in the former phase of drying, and the contents of non-protein nitrogen (NPN), free amino acids and TBA increase significantly over the whole phase of drying. The dominant microbial groups in cured fish were lactic acid bacteria, Micrococcus, Staphylococcus and yeast. Both curing and drying processes affect the composition of free amino acids in the muscle of silver carp. The contents of methionine, glutamic acid, valine, serine and threonine are higher in cured fish than those in raw muscle, and they may play an important role in flavor formation of cured silver carp.

Effects of Active Ingredients in Black Tea, Green Tea and Oolong Tea on Antioxidant Capability
CHEN Jin-e,FENG Hui-jun,ZHANG Hai-rong*
2009, 30(3):  62-66.  doi:10.7506/spkx1002-6630-200903013
Asbtract ( 1557 )   HTML ( 1)   PDF (254KB) ( 1762 )  
Related Articles | Metrics

Polysaccharides were extracted from different teas with hot water and their contents were determined by sulfuric acid-phenol method, while polyphenols were extracted with alcohol and their contents were determined by ferrous tartrate method. Then the scavenging effects of tea polysaccharide and polyphenol on free radicals were examined by DPPH·, salicylic acid and pyrogallol methods respectively, and the antioxidant capabilities of 8 kinds of tea were comparatively studied. Results showed that the polysaccharides contents in different teas are from 2.19% up to 2.89% and their change order is as following: semifermented oolong tea > black tea > green tea. The polyphenol contents in different teas are from 1.71% up to 9.75% and their change order is as following: green tea > semifermented oolong tea > black tea. The order of antioxidant capability is black tea > green tea > semifermented oolong tea (DPPH· and salicylic acid methods) or black tea > semifermented oolong tea > green tea (pyrogallol method). Both tea polysaccharides and polyphenols are main antioxidants in different kinds of teas. The antioxidant capability of green tea mainly depends on polyphenols, while that of black tea mainly depends on polysaccharides. Furthermore, the antioxidant capabilities of both polysaccharides and polyphenols are proportional to their contents in various tea extracts except aqueous polysaccharide extract of oolong tea.

Physical Properties of Dietary Fiber from Apple-pear Pomace
ZHANG Xian,YAN Yan,LI Fan-zhu*
2009, 30(3):  114-117.  doi:10.7506/spkx1002-6630-200903024
Asbtract ( 1486 )   HTML ( 0)   PDF (239KB) ( 508 )  
Related Articles | Metrics

Physical properties and compositions of dietary fiber sources (DFS) from Apple-pear pomace by chemical method were studied. The results showed that the cellulose content of DFS prepared from apple-pear pomace is high, reaching 40%, and phenolic compound content is 0.37 to 0.58mg/g. The water-holding capacity and oil absorption are 3.96 to 6.75 g/g and 1.80 to 2.84 g/g, respectively, and the swellability is 3.05 to 5.17 ml/g. The water-holding capacity, oil absorption and swellability of DFS reduce with the particle size decreasing, but L value shows reverse result.

Establishment of Hybridoma Cell Lines Secreting Anti-ractopamine Monoclonal Antibody and Identification of Their Immunological Properties
ZHANG Hai-tang1,WANG Zi-liang1,*,DENG Rui-guang2,ZHONG Hua1,FAN Guo-ying1
2009, 30(3):  175-179.  doi:10.7506/spkx1002-6630-200903039
Asbtract ( 1498 )   HTML ( 0)   PDF (438KB) ( 393 )  
Related Articles | Metrics

The active group carboxyl was introduced to ractopamine (RAC) and formed RAC semialdehyde (RAC-SA) which has hapten structure by chemical modification. The method of mixed anhydride (MA) was used to conjugate RAC-SA to bovine serum albumin (BSA) and obtain artificial antigen BSA-RAC identified by infrared (IR), ultraviolet (UV) and SDS-PAGE. Balb/C mice were immunized with BSA-RAC and hybridoma lines that secrete monoclonal antibody against RAC (RAC mAb) were established through cell fusion and then screened using indirect ELISA. Blocking ELISA and the immunological traits of RAC mAb were identified. The results showed that BSA-RAC is synthesized successfully and its conjugation ratio between RAC and BSA is about 24.5:1. Three hybridoma lines of 3F10, 3H12 and 4D8 are screened out and the best one is 4D8 with indirect ELISA titers of 1:1.28×103 in supernatant and 1:6.4×105 in ascites. The isotype of the mAb is IgG1/κ and its affinity constant (Ka) is 1.65×1010L/mol. The mAb shows good sensitivity with an IC50 of 5.7 ng/m lto RAC, 22.3% cross-reactivity with dobutamine and little or no cross-reactivity with other compounds. Establishment of hybridoma lines that secrete RAC mAb makes it possible to develop immunoassay of RAC residues in animal food.

Preliminary Study on Antagonistic Effect of Aspergillus niger Mutant against Aspergillus flavus TO
SHI Cui-e1,JIANG Li-ke2,*
2009, 30(3):  217-221.  doi:10.7506/spkx1002-6630-200903049
Asbtract ( 1338 )   HTML ( 1)   PDF (938KB) ( 627 )  
Related Articles | Metrics

Aflatoxin produced by Aspergillus flavus TO has strong carcinogenesis. Aspergillus niger mutant, resulted from original Aspergillus niger infiltrated with N+ ion beams at dose of 90×2.6×1013 N+/cm2, was selected to suppress growth of Aspergillus flavus TO and favored to be applied in control of a secondly possible contamination in Aspergillus flavus-contaminated raw materials in ferment industry. Based on such experiments as cultivation of Aspergillus flavus TO and N+-infiltrated Aspergillus niger strains together, and cultivation of Aspergillus niger and Aspergillus flavus TO strains alone and together, the results showed that Aspergillus flavus TO strains are inhibited by both Aspergillus niger and N+-infiltrated Aspergillus niger strains, and the inhibition in the former is slight but that in the latter is almost complete. In addition, grey and slim mycelia in Aspergillus flavus TO strains are also shown in the cultivation together with N+-infiltrated Aspergillus niger strains. Moreover, extracts from media were also examined by aflatoxin fluorescence analysis. Relatively obvious signals are observed in the Aspergillus flavus TO group, faint signals in the Aspergillus niger group, but no signals in the N+-infiltrated Aspergillus niger strain group. In conclusion, the original Aspergillus niger strain exerts slight inhibition against Aspergillus flavus TO growth and makes the decline in synthesis of aflatoxin and related pigments, while the Aspergillus niger mutant strain shows significant inhibition against the growth of Aspergillus flavus TO strain compared with the control. Therefore, the Aspergillus niger mutant strain has the potential be introduced to alcohol industry to prevent from Aspergillus flavus TO contamination and ensure safety in the ferment ation process.

Comparison of Nutrients and Microbial Diversity between Traditional and Commercial Soybean Pastes
GAO Xiu-zhi1,2,WANG Xiao-fen1,LI Xian-mei1,WANG Hui1,YI Xin-xin2,CUI Zong-Jun1,*
2009, 30(3):  222-226.  doi:10.7506/spkx1002-6630-200903050
Asbtract ( 1490 )   HTML ( 0)   PDF (330KB) ( 496 )  
Related Articles | Metrics

Nutrients and microbial diversity were analyzed and compared among samples of two traditional and two commercial soybean pastes. Results showed that traditional soybean pastes have richer fragrance and more delicious flavor than commercial soybean pastes by sensory evaluation. All of soybean pastes have abundant nutrients and flavor matters. The traditional soybean pastes have obviously higher concentration than commercial soybean pastes in the important flavor compounds such as lactic acid and amino-acid nitrogen. Content of water-soluble carbohydrate (WSC) in commercial soybean pastes is half of dry matter, which exceeds twice of WSC in traditional soybean pastes. Denaturing gradient gel electrophoresis (DGGE) analysis indicated that Shandong soybean paste, Yanji soybean paste and Tianyuan commercial soybean paste have similar profiles. Uncultured bacteria, Lactococcus lactis and Bacillus licheniformis are predominant species in these three soybean pastes, while Lactococcus lactis and Bacillus pumilus are predominant species in Longfei soybean paste.

Protective Effects of Some Polyphenol Compounds on Human Hepatocyte Damages Induced by Hydrogen Peroxide or Carbon Tetrachloride
ZHANG Xin,ZHAO Xin-huai*
2009, 30(3):  262-266.  doi:10.7506/spkx1002-6630-200903059
Asbtract ( 1354 )   HTML ( 0)   PDF (387KB) ( 324 )  
Related Articles | Metrics

The potential hepatoprotective effects of five polyphenols, such as tea polyphenol, gallic acid, quercetin, kaempferol, apigenin and α-tocopherol (as a control) against oxidation damages of human hepatocyte induced by hydrogen peroxide or carbon tetrachloride were evaluated. The results showed that pre-treatment of hepatocytes with polyphenols at concentrations of 5, 10 and 20 mg/L for 1 h not only improve cell viability and the content of GSH, but also reduce LDH leakage and the formation of MDA in cells. The hepatoprotective effects of polyphenol compounds decrease in the following order: gallic acid > quercetin > tea polyphenol > apigenin > α-tocopherol > kaempferol. The protective mechanism may be associated with the high free radicalscavenging activity of polyphenlos.

Research Progress on Rapid Methods for Detecting Psychrophilic Bacteria in Raw Milk
LU Yuan,YIN Yuan-ming,TANG Jia-ni,LIU Dong-hong,YE Xing-qian*
2009, 30(3):  274-280.  doi:10.7506/spkx1002-6630-200903062
Asbtract ( 1354 )   HTML ( 0)   PDF (224KB) ( 706 )  
Related Articles | Metrics

Being the preponderant microorganism in refrigerated raw milk, psychrophilic bacteria increase very swiftly and produce some cellular enzymes with high thermal stability such as lipases and proteases. After treated at high temperature, these enzymes are still active and continue to decompose the fat and protein in raw milk so that the quality of dairy products decreases. Therefore, recently more and more researchers focus the attention on the rapid and exact detection of psychrophilic bacteria in raw milk. This paper discussed many detection methods and compared their advantages and disadvantages.
